What is FSSL insider buying?

$FSSL insider buying refers to open-market purchases of FS Specialty Lending Fund stock by corporate insiders — officers, directors, and shareholders owning more than 10% of the company. Every purchase is disclosed to the SEC on Form 4 within two business days and is shown on this page.

Why does FSSL insider activity matter?

Insiders have the best view into FS Specialty Lending Fund's operations. When they buy their own stock with personal money — rather than selling option grants — it signals conviction. Clusters of insider buying (two or more insiders purchasing within 14 days) have historically preceded above-market returns.
